Plant Anatomy is the study of internal structure of the plants and it is also called phytotomy. Recent techniques are useful in investigating the cellular levels and also involved in the sectioning of tissues and microscopy.

Plant anatomy provides information on shape, structure and size of plants. As a part of botany, it focuses on the structural parts and systems that build up a plant. Plant body consists of three major vegetative organs which are the root, the stem, and the leaf, as well as reproductive parts that include flowers, fruits, and seeds.

Plant Morphology is the study of physical form and external structure of plants and it is also called Phytomorphology. It is different from plant anatomy, which shows study on internal organs at microscopic levels.

Plant Morphology is useful in visual identification of plants, where can identify vegetative structure of plants and reproductive structure, identify by spines, leaves, appearance of a plant, plant growth habit and by the pattern of branch.
